Full Stack Engineer

Posted 16 Days Ago
New York, NY
Mid level
Artificial Intelligence • Software
The Role
The Full Stack Engineer will design, develop, and maintain scalable web applications and APIs for AI-driven products. Responsibilities include back-end service development, front-end component implementation, database management, performance optimization, code reviews, and staying current with industry trends.
Summary Generated by Built In

Office Location: Lower Manhattan, NY - Hybrid 

US Citizenship Required

About Accrete:

Accrete AI is a dynamic and innovative company focused on transforming the future of artificial intelligence. We specialize in creating advanced AI solutions that turn complex data into actionable insights, driving real-world impact for businesses and government organizations. Our team thrives on creativity and collaboration, working together to push the boundaries of AI technology.

Job Description:

We are seeking a talented and motivated Full Stack Engineer with 3-5 years of experience to join our dynamic engineering team. In this role, you will work closely with other engineers, data scientists, and product managers to design, develop, and deploy scalable web applications and APIs that power our Argus. You should be comfortable working across the entire stack, from front-end user interfaces to back-end services and databases.

Key Responsibilities:

  • Develop and Maintain Full-Stack Applications: Design, build, and maintain web applications and services that are efficient, robust, and scalable
  • Collaborate with Cross-Functional Teams: Work closely with product managers, designers, and other engineers to gather requirements, design features, and ensure the successful deployment of software
  • Develop Back-End Services: Build and maintain back-end APIs and services using Node.js, Python, or similar technologies
  • Implement Front-End Components (less than 5-10% of job): Develop responsive and intuitive front-end interfaces using modern JavaScript frameworks (e.g., React, Angular, or Vue.js)
  • Database Management: Design and optimize database schemas, write efficient queries, and ensure data integrity and performance
  • Performance Optimization: Identify bottlenecks and optimize application performance, ensuring that our applications scale effectively with increased load
  • Code Review and Quality Assurance: Participate in code reviews, write unit and integration tests, and ensure code quality across the team
  • Stay Current with Industry Trends: Keep up with emerging technologies and best practices in web development and software engineering

 Qualifications:

Accrete values diverse experiences and we encourage applicants to apply even if you don’t meet all of the following criteria. While having all of the qualifications listed below can certainly make you a strong candidate, we acknowledge that great candidates aren’t defined simply by a list of skills. If you think you have other experiences that would make you a good match for this role, please apply!

  • Education: Bachelor’s degree in Computer Science, Engineering, or a related field
  • Experience: 2 or more years of professional experience as a Full-Stack Engineer or in a similar role
  • Back-End Skills: Experience with back-end development using Python; familiarity with RESTful API design and development
  • Database Knowledge: Experience with relational databases (e.g., PostgreSQL, MySQL) and/or NoSQL databases (e.g., MongoDB)
  • Version Control: Proficiency with Git and collaborative development workflows
  • Testing: Experience with unit testing, integration testing, and other end-to-end testing strategies
  • Problem-Solving Skills: Strong analytical and problem-solving abilities, with a keen attention to detail
  • Communication: Excellent communication skills, with the ability to collaborate effectively in a team environment
  • Front-End Expertise: Proficiency in front-end development with frameworks like React, Angular, or Vue.js, along with a strong understanding of HTML, CSS, and JavaScript/TypeScript

Preferred Qualifications:

  • Cloud Experience: Familiarity with cloud platforms such as AWS, Google Cloud, or Azure, including experience with deploying and managing applications in a cloud environment
  • DevOps: Experience with CI/CD pipelines, Docker, Kubernetes, or similar DevOps tools
  • AI/ML Exposure: Basic understanding or experience with AI and machine learning concepts

Salary Range: 140k-170k

Benefits: 

  • Fortune 500 level core benefits package: health, dental, vision, Rx, long-term disability, short-term disability, life insurance, and 401(k) traditional and roth 
  • Unlimited PTO & all U.S. federal holidays off
  • Lunch everyday 
  • Company events include happy hours, team bonding events, game nights, and more 
  • Our office is stocked with healthy and delicious lunches, snacks, beverages and more

We offer a competitive salary, benefits package, and opportunities for growth and advancement within the company. If you are an innovative and results-driven leader, we encourage you to apply for this exciting opportunity.

Accrete is an equal opportunity/affirmative action employer. All qualified applicants will receive consideration for employment without regard to sex, gender identity, sexual orientation, race, color, religion, national origin, disability, protected Veteran status, age, or any other characteristic protected by law.

Top Skills

Node.js
Python
The Company
HQ: New York, NY
79 Employees
Hybrid Workplace
Year Founded: 2017

What We Do

Accrete is a Prime Defense Contractor delivering configurable dual-use AI solutions that automate complex analytical work to both government and commercial customers with a focus on defense, intelligence, and cybersecurity.

Jobs at Similar Companies

Louisville, CO, USA
69 Employees
111K-185K Annually

Jobba Trade Technologies, Inc. Logo Jobba Trade Technologies, Inc.

Senior Back End Developer

Cloud • Information Technology • Productivity • Professional Services • Software
Remote
Hybrid
Chicago, IL, USA
45 Employees

Similar Companies Hiring

TrainingPeaks (A Peaksware Company) Thumbnail
Software • Fitness
Louisville, CO
69 Employees
bet365 Thumbnail
Software • Gaming • eSports • Digital Media • Automation
Denver, Colorado
6100 Employees
Jobba Trade Technologies, Inc. Thumbnail
Software • Professional Services • Productivity • Information Technology • Cloud
Chicago, IL
45 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account